what is the ph of a solution that comtains 1.7 x 10^-4 M hydronium ions?

Respuesta :

magalieisik magalieisik
  • 12-04-2020

Answer:

The pH of the solution is 3,77

Explanation:

The pH indicates the acidity or basicity of a substance. PH values between 0 and less than 7 indicate acidic solutions, 7 neutral and greater than 7 to 14 basic. It is calculated as

pH = -log (H 30+)

pH= -log (1.7x10^ -4)

pH=3,77
